This tour is created so you can experience the city and nature in one. You will visit all of the important historical spots in Belgrade, but will also visit Avala Mountain, must-see attraction just outside of city.

Your guide will wait for you at the airport. The drive will take approx. half an hour to your first stop – Belgrade fortress. This is a great place for an introduction to Serbian history and its heritage. Born at the confluence of two rivers, the Sava and Danube, Belgrade hides many stories which will be revealed to you during this tour. Continuing your walk you will pass through Kalemegdan Park, the most visited park in the city.

Next to the park is main pedestrian zone and Republic Square. If you want to feel like a local, we suggest you take a break and try domestic coffee in the oldest restaurant in the city, “?”. If you are hungry, we suggest you try some of the local specialties as well. After a break, you continue through the Prince Michael Street, the main shopping street with many boutiques and souvenir shops. You will pass next to the Republic Square where a monument dedicated to liberator of Serbia proudly stands.

Driving through one of the main streets where many governmental institutions are located, you will reach the fifth biggest Orthodox Church in the world, the Temple of St. Sava. While learning about medieval history, you will understand the significance of this church to the Serbian people.

And now, just a half an hour drive away is your next destination, Avala Mountain. Belgraders like to escape here, especially during weekend. Be prepared to climb a little bit, because we need to pass “a few” stairs before reaching the monument. But, you won’t regret it! Avala Tower is your next stop. On the top of the tower you can enjoy a drink, while admiring an outstanding view of Belgrade and Serbia.

On your way back, you will visit Zemun, an old and beautiful part of the city. This area is known for its narrow cobblestone streets, and houses from 18 and 19th century.

You will be taken to the airport (or hotel) just in time for your next flight.
